     80 uint8_t shift_led_indicator_left(uint8_t scale_indicator_col){
     81     if (scale_indicator_col > 0) {
     82         scale_indicator_col--;
     83     } else {
     84         scale_indicator_col = 11;
     85     }
     86     return scale_indicator_col;
     87 }
     88 
     89 uint8_t shift_led_indicator_right(uint8_t scale_indicator_col){
     90     if (scale_indicator_col < 11) {
     91         scale_indicator_col++;
     92     } else {
     93         scale_indicator_col = 0;
     94     }
     95     return scale_indicator_col;
     96 }
